Warning Signs You Need Sprinkler System Water Removal

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can show a serious water damage issue that needs immediate attention. Act fast to prevent costly repairs and health risks associated with water dam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show mold growth or water damage. If you notice musty smells in your home or basement, it’s time to call our team. Mold growth can spread quickly and cause serious health issues.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ains can show water damage or leaks in your sprinkler system. If you notice water stains on your walls or ceilings, it’s essential to address the issue immediately. Water damage can spread quickly and cause costly repairs.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or moisture issues. If you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s time to call our team. Water damage can compromise the structural integrity of your property.

Unexplained Increases in Your Water Bill

An unexpected increase in your water bill can show a hidden leak or water damage issue. If you notice a sudden spike in your water bill, it’s time to investigate. Hidden leaks can waste thousands of gallons of water and cause costly repairs.

Visible Water Leaks or Puddles

Visible water leaks or puddles can show a serious issue with your sprinkler system. If you notice water leaking from your pipes or sprinkler heads, it’s essential to address the issue immediately. Water damage can spread quickly and cause costly repairs.

Sprinkler System Water Removal Cost in Caledonia, WI

The cost of Sprinkler System Water Removal in Caledonia, WI can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on typical price ranges for our services.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and we offer free estimates to ensure you know what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response and Assessment $500 – $2,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Water Extraction and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and drying time
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ions used, and level of sanitizing required
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ials used, and level of reconstruction required
